Facebook to go open source.


Facebook is one of the leading competitors in the race to be the best online social networking site.
www.facebook.com has recently given information to several sources that they will be going open source in a matter of days.


What does this mean?
For those who arn't sure what open source is, or what this means for facebook. It basically means that the immediate effect will be to allow any social network to become Facebook Platform compatible - meaning application developers can easily take their Facebook applications and have them run on those social networks, too.

This will mean, many programs and software tools, can be expected in the up-coming times.
